Precision Radar and Pressure Sensor for Challenging Environments
The LIDoTT® Sensor R is a high-precision radar and pressure sensor designed for accurate level and depth measurements in sewers, CSOs, and large pipes. As part of the LIDoTT® Smart Solution, it offers seamless sensor transitions, advanced integration options, and exceptional durability in harsh environments. This sensor can also function independently with existing data logger setups.

Unmatched Precision and Reliability
The LIDoTT® Sensor R provides continuous monitoring for levels up to 17 metres, ensuring comprehensive data collection. The advanced radar sensor measures water levels up to 7 metres below its installation point with an accuracy of ±5mm. When levels exceed this range, the integrated pressure sensor takes over, measuring depths up to 10 metres above the sensor with an accuracy of ±0.2% FS. This seamless transition between radar and pressure measurement ensures there are no gaps in data collection, delivering consistent and reliable information essential for effective network management.
- Radar Level Sensor: Measures levels up to 7 metres with an accuracy of ±5mm.
- Pressure Sensor: Monitors depths up to 10 metres with an accuracy of ±0.2% FS.
- Temperature Sensor: Ensures precise calibration with an accuracy of ±1.5°C (only available with LIDoTT® Smart).
Engineered for Durability in Tough Conditions
The LIDoTT® Sensor R is fully submersible and built to excel in harsh, corrosive environments, enduring extreme weather and chemical exposure. With a replaceable external battery pack lasting up to 7 years, it is ideal for remote locations without mains power. The sensor’s design minimises the need for routine maintenance, ensuring reliable performance in demanding conditions.
Operating effectively across a temperature range of -20°C to +60°C, the LIDoTT® Sensor R features an IP69K-rated housing and IP68 Mil-Spec connectors, providing exceptional protection against dust, water, and high-pressure cleaning. This ensures the system remains functional and robust in the most challenging environments.
Advanced Data Communication and Configuration
The LIDoTT® Smart datalogger offers unparalleled flexibility with configurable data logging intervals (2, 5, 10, or 15 minutes) and transmission frequencies (from 5 minutes to 24 hours). Choose from 2G, 4G LTE-M1, and 4G NB-IoT networks, with 2G as a fallback option to ensure continuous connectivity. The system integrates seamlessly with any data platform via API, offering real-time access to critical data. Configuration, software, and firmware updates can all be performed remotely over the air (OTA), reducing the need for site visits and keeping the system up-to-date and optimised.
